What are the common types of titanium anodes? What industrial applications are they suitable for?
Titanium anodes can be divided into various types based on their surface coating materials and application requirements. The most common ones are Mixed Metal Oxide (MMO) titanium anodes and platinum-plated titanium anodes. They are widely used in electroplating, water treatment, chlor-alkali industry, cathodic protection, and other fields.
Main Titanium Anode Types and Applications:
| Anode Type | Typical Coating | Main Application Areas | Advantages |
|---|---|---|---|
| MMO Titanium Anodes | Ru-Ir-Ti (Ruthenium-Iridium-Titanium) | Chlor-alkali industry, electroplating, electrolysis of water, seawater desalination, cathodic protection | High electrocatalytic activity, long lifespan, resistance to chlorine evolution, low energy consumption |
| Ir-Ta-Ti (Iridium-Tantalum-Titanium) | Oxygen evolution reactions, electrolytic copper foil, PCB electroplating, precious metal electroplating | Excellent oxygen evolution performance, acid resistance |
| Platinum-plated Titanium Anodes | Pt (Platinum) | Precious metal electroplating, water electrolysis, electrochemical sensors, organic synthesis | High purity, excellent corrosion resistance, suitable for applications requiring high product purity |
MMO titanium anodes, especially ruthenium-iridium coatings, have shown excellent performance in chlor-alkali electrolysis, effectively replacing traditional graphite anodes, improving current efficiency and product quality.
